+ ## Build-time environment variables
56
+
57
+ Use `env` to pass environment variables during the build step. This is useful for frameworks like Next.js that inline environment variables at build time.
58
+
59
+ ```hcl
60
+ build "web" {
61
+ base = "node"
62
+ command = "npm run build"
63
+
64
+ env = {
65
+ NEXT_PUBLIC_API_URL = service.api.public_url
66
+ NODE_ENV = "production"
67
+ }
68
+ }
69
+ ```
70
+
71
+ Supported reference types:
72
+
73
+ - String literals (e.g., `"production"`)
74
+ - `service.<name>.public_url` - The public domain of another service
75
+

+ ## Querying the database
38
+
39
+ Use `specific psql` to connect to a development database. This will start the database if it's not already running.
40
+
41
+ ```sh
42
+ # Interactive session
43
+ specific psql main
44
+
45
+ # Run a single query (useful for coding agents)
46
+ specific psql main -- -c "SELECT * FROM users LIMIT 5"
47
+
48
+ # List tables
49
+ specific psql main -- -c "\dt"
50
+ ```
51
+

+ ### Public inter-service communication
161
+
162
+ The private communication does not work in the case of a frontend or client service needing to speak with a backend service, as `private_url` is not externally reachable. In that case, the backend service MUST expose a public endpoint. The frontend or client service can then reference that endpoint using `public_url`:
163
+
164
+ ```hcl
165
+ service "web" {
166
+ build = build.web
167
+ command = "npm start"
168
+
169
+ endpoint {
170
+ public = true
171
+ }
172
+
173
+ env = {
174
+ PORT = port
175
+ }
176
+ }
177
+
178
+ service "api" {
179
+ build = build.api
180
+ command = "./api"
181
+
182
+ endpoint {
183
+ public = true
184
+ }
185
+
186
+ env = {
187
+ PORT = port
188
+ CORS_ORIGIN = service.web.public_url
189
+ }
136
190
  }
137
191
  ```
